I applied online. The process took 3 weeks. I interviewed at Amazon (New York, NY) in Feb 2015
Interview
The first round was a very simple online test, but you need to be pretty fast because the online compiler takes time. Nothing you wouldn't know beforehand.
The interview questions were pretty easy. Basic oops and algorithms questions. The interviewer seemed to be in a hurry though, and created a slightly stressful environment. They asked me to code on Collabedit.

I applied online. I interviewed at Amazon (Calgary, AB) in Jun 2026
Interview
Online Assessment is the first step in the process. I didn’t have an HR phone screening and went straight to the OA after applying. It was sent to me about a week after I submitted my application.

The first question is LeetCode style algorithms question, and the second question gives a full stack repo (choice of Java, NodeJS, or Django) and asks to solve a backend issue which is causing a bug in the frontend. Unit tests must pass to pass the second question. You can run both backend/frontend indivdually or together
